Moat Homes is hiring a Hub Officer in Sittingbourne, aiming to empower communities through meaningful activities. The role involves creating engaging programs for various age groups and facilitating connections.

Candidates should possess strong communication, IT skills, and a passion for community work. Competitive salary range is £10,850 - £13,562 per annum plus a car allowance.

Join a supportive team dedicated to positive community impact and personal development.

How to prepare for a job interview at Moat Homes

Know Your Community

Before the interview, take some time to research the community Moat Homes serves. Understand their needs and challenges, and think about how you can contribute to empowering them through engaging programmes.

Showcase Your Communication Skills

As a Hub Officer, strong communication is key. Prepare examples of how you've effectively communicated with diverse groups in the past. This could be through workshops, meetings, or even social media campaigns.

Demonstrate Your Passion for Community Work

Be ready to share your personal experiences that highlight your commitment to community work. Whether it's volunteering or leading initiatives, showing genuine passion will resonate well with the interviewers.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ect questions that ask how you'd handle specific situations in the community. Think about potential challenges you might face and how you would creatively solve them to foster connections and inspire change.
